**Overview**

The Deputy Head of Policy, Communications and Strategy assists the Head of Policy, Communications and Strategy with the day-today delivery of VALS’ policy and advocacy work. This includes management of the team, strategic planning, providing support to the CEO, and representing and advocating for VALS priorities on relevant working groups and forums

**Key Performance Indicators, Duties & Responsibility**
- Contribute to the core work of the Policy, Communications and Strategy team. This includes research and policy development, government and stakeholder engagement, communications and media activities, and supporting all teams across VALS
- Work closely with the Head of Policy, Communications and Strategy to oversee and manage the strategy and day-to-day operation of the team and independently work on tasks relevant to the team’s work as delegated by the Head of Policy, Communications and Strategy.
- Manage and develop staff, contractors and volunteers.
- Contribute to planning and management of the Policy, Communications and Strategy team budget
- Design and implement planning documents
- Provide strong stakeholder engagement and management support
- As directed, undertake other duties which are incidental and peripheral to the main tasks, provided that such duties are reasonably within the employee’s skills, competence and training.

**Key Selection Criteria**

Relevant qualifications such as a Bachelor or Masters degree in Politics, Law, Communications, Journalism or Business Management and/or extensive experience in developing and managing external facing policy and advocacy teams

Strong leadership and management skills, including people management skills

4 years+ experience in policy, advocacy, or social campaign roles - particularly working with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ander communities

Strong organisational, time management and planning skills; with an ability to work autonomously and within a team

High proficiency in Microsoft Office and media monitoring tools

Ability to work with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ples and acknowledge their diverse backgrounds, personalities and varying needs and the unique cultural ways in which they may be expressed.

Experience working in the non-profit sector.
